Delaware County Solid Waste Authority is seeking a Full-Time Mechanic Asistant to work at our landfill in Boyertown, PA. This position is primarily responsible for the maintenance and repair of light duty trucks but will also involve learning how to repair heavy equipment. Tasks for this mechanic will be directed by the Operations Manager.
The duties of this position include:
· Advance DCSWA’s mission, philosophy, and commitment to the community by embracing these values and demonstrating them in your everyday activities.
· Conduct repair and diagnosis issues with assigned vehicles
· Coordinate work orders with repair slips to be sure that required tasks are completed.
· List materials used and time spent on work orders to maintain records of repairs and fabrications.
· Ensure the proper equipment and supplies are available for performance of all daily activities.
· Communicate to the Lead Mechanic any needs for parts and/or supplies.
· Assist maintenance personnel in order for them to adhere to operational requirements and perform their jobs.
· Perform all levels of preventative maintenance services on truck and trailer equipment.
· Maintain work area appearance and safety.
· Make decisions and display problem solving skills.
· Perform all work in a safe, effective, and reliable manner.
· Use personal protective equipment required for position.
· Inspect and pull tires for capping.
· Assist with facility maintenance and operations as needed and directed.
· Help with snow removal for safe operation of Rolling Hills Landfill.
· Support a culture of safety by performing all responsibilities in accordance with DCSWA safety policies and procedures and take a proactive approach to ensure a safe working environment for employees and customers.

Work Environment and Physical Demands:
· Employees in this position normally perform the work inside. However, when there are breakdowns, work will be performed at the site of the breakdown, which may involve working in the area of moving traffic and inclement outdoor conditions.
· Exposure to weather extremes, exhaust fumes, chemical fumes, acid, oil, grease, high noise levels, and hazardous materials and equipment. Hazards may be reduced through the exercise of safety precautions.
· Occasionally lift, pull, drag and carry up to 150 lbs.
· Endure physical demands of the position, including climbing ladders, working at heights up to 60 feet, long periods of standing and walking, and repetitive arm and hand movements.
· Working in cramped areas and contorted positions as needed.
Equipment Used:
· Broom/mop/shovel
· Tools (hand, electric and air)
· Voltmeter, A/C equipment
· Tow motors, hydraulic jacks, scissor lift, boom lift
· Plasma cutter
· Safety equipment (gloves, face shield, glasses, etc.)
